Tom Brady, who was harshly mocked during Netflix’s “The Roast of Tom Brady,” has vowed to never willingly be the subject of such jokes again. Comedian Nikki Glaser is challenging his resolve. Glaser discussed Brady’s post-roast regrets in an interview with “Today” hosts Hoda Kotb and Jenna Bush Hager.

Following the star-studded event that poked fun at Brady’s football career and his public divorce from Gisele Bündchen, Brady remarked that he "wouldn't do that again because of how it affected" his family. Glaser, hailed by Kotb and Bush Hager as the roast's "winner," suggested that Brady "maybe didn't anticipate the backlash from his family and how it would affect them.”

She also expressed disbelief that Brady was unaware of what he was getting into, noting that he could have prepared by watching footage of previous comedy roasts. “I think it’s something you say after the fact,” she said. “It’s impossible for me to believe he didn’t consider what could have happened.”

“The Roast of Tom Brady” streamed live on Netflix earlier this month and featured jabs from host Kevin Hart and panelists Will Ferrell, Jeff Ross, Rob Gronkowski, Kim Kardashian, and Andrew Schulz, among others. Brady, on a Tuesday episode of “The Pivot” podcast, said he “loved” being the target of the jokes but “didn’t like the way it affected my kids.”

He has three children: a 16-year-old son with actor Bridget Moynahan and two children with ex-wife Bündchen. Glaser joked Wednesday that she thinks Brady couldn’t take the heat because “no one’s ever said a bad thing to him in the past 30 years.” While the comedian said she and her fellow roasters agreed beforehand not to bring Brady’s children into the mix, Glaser added there weren’t specific guidelines on which topics were off-limits.

Nikki Glaser Blasts Ben Affleck for Bombing at Tom Brady Roast

It's been a tough month for Ben Affleck. Before rumors about his alleged divorce from Jennifer Lopez began circulating, the “Argo” actor had a cringe-worthy appearance at Netflix’s Tom Brady roast on May 5. Affleck went on an odd rant about social media that didn’t sit well with the audience or viewers at home.

Nikki Glaser, who was arguably the MVP of the roast, criticized Affleck’s performance during an interview on “KFC Radio.” “I haven’t watched it again because I don’t like to see people bomb,” Glaser, 39, said in an Instagram clip shared Saturday. “He didn’t prepare,” the “Inside Amy Schumer” comedian remarked about Affleck.

“He’s someone who’s famous enough to think this is beneath him, so he just saw it as a favor. He probably thought it wouldn’t be a big deal.” Glaser speculated that Affleck pitched an angle to the writers about “being mad at tweets,” which the radio show host found “so self-centered” of the Oscar winner.

“There were jokes that could have filled his set and been amazing, but either they couldn’t get him on the phone to work it out, he didn’t practice enough, or he just chose a bad premise and had to stick with it,” Glaser explained. She added, “It didn’t work right away, so it’s not gonna work later.”

Glaser isn’t the only comedian to criticize Affleck’s performance. Dane Cook, who attended the event but didn’t participate, said Affleck came in “last place” in a viral TikTok video. Affleck was roasted on social media for his perplexing rant. On X, formerly known as Twitter, one user compared his speech to a “car crash.”

Fans also speculated that the “Air” star had undergone plastic surgery before the Netflix special, but insiders later told the Daily Mail that wasn’t the case. A source said, “Ben has been criticized repeatedly for decades; this is nothing new. And now people thinking he had a face-lift is just a joke.” “The Roast of Tom Brady” is streaming now on Netflix.
